暂无介绍
操作系统是管理计算机的系统软件。它的任务包括管理计算机资源和满足他们的通信需求。内核是操作系统的主要部分,主要负责与硬件资源的直接通信。没有内核,操作系统就无法运行。但是,由于操作系统的内核与许多其他组件一起被掩埋,大多数用户都不知道内核的存在。...
若你们不懂计算机,处理器和内核之间的区别可能是一个令人费解的话题。处理器或CPU就像计算机系统的大脑。它负责所有的核心功能,如算术、逻辑和控制操作。传统处理器(如奔腾处理器)内部只有一个内核,而现代处理器是多核处理器。多核处理器在处理器包中有几个核心,其中核心是处理器最基本的计算单元。一个内核一次只能执行一条程序指令(如果有超线程功能,则可以执行多条),但是由多个内核组成的处理器可以根据内核的数量...
UNIX和LINUX都是开源操作系统。开源意味着操作系统的源代码可以被检查和改进。UNIX操作系统是在LINUX之前开发的。两者之间有一定的区别。...
微软Windows是微软公司生产的操作系统。事实上,他们有一系列以这个名字命名的操作系统(如WindowsXP、WindowsVista、Windows7等等)。...
计算机有两种工作模式,即用户模式和内核模式。当计算机运行应用软件时,它处于用户模式。应用软件请求硬件后,计算机进入内核模式。核心是计算机系统的核心。随后,计算机频繁地在用户模式和内核模式之间切换。操作系统的大多数关键任务都是在内核模式下执行的。用户模式和内核模式的关键区别在于,用户模式是应用程序运行的模式,内核模式是计算机访问硬件资源时进入的特权模式。...
系统调用和库调用与计算机的操作系统有关。计算机可以在两种模式下运行,即用户模式和内核模式。系统调用和库调用的关键区别在于,系统调用是内核提供的进入内核模式访问硬件资源的函数,而库调用是由编程库提供的函数。例如,open()是一个系统调用,而fopen()是一个库调用。当C程序中的fopen()时,使用stdio.h头库。然后在内核中使用系统调用“open(),”来完成文件打开任务。...
UNIX是美国电话电报公司(AT&T)在20世纪60年代开发的一种操作系统,旨在为程序员提供一个多用户、多任务的系统。UNIX的设计原则是,可以灵活地集成简单但功能强大的实用程序,以提供范围广泛的任务。然而,术语“UNIX”更多地指的是一类操作系统(符合特定规范,基于原始UNIX操作系统的规范),而不是操作系统的特定实现。Solaris是UNIX的商业变体,与HP-UX和AIX一样,带有UNIX商...
Windows是一个封闭源代码的操作系统,大部分都是基于微软开发的软件。Ubuntu是一个基于Linux的开源操作系统,它使用了debianlinux操作系统的很大一部分。反过来,这两个操作系统都使用Linux内核,它是在两个项目之外开发的。Ubuntu使用的Linux内核是单片的,Windows使用的是混合内核。Ubuntu是基于Canonical公司的,也是基于社区的,Windows是严格基于...
Linux和BSD之间有很多相似之处:它们都基于UNIX。在大多数情况下,这两个系统都是由非商业组织开发的。尽管如此,在好吧。那个BSD代码不被任何一个用户“控制”,这被许多人视为一个巨大的好处。而Linux内核主要由linustorvalds控制。bsd与UNIX非常相似,因为它们实际上是传统UNIX的直接派生。Linux支持硬件的速度比BSD快得多。...
地球内核和外内核的主要区别在于,地球的内核是我们星球的最内层,而外层核心是围绕内核的层。...